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 579 78198378608 7585248 8873835
21267536176 6469033
21267536176 6469033
59 2128 60
All about undefined
Interested in learning more?
21267536176 6469033
59 2128 60
See more
89750375 82057804 9638758
07100 61010467231 89 20 966368407
See more
66675207054 15254585584 226
00 42330 13909 3899738953
See more